Discover Smarter Ways to Search with Reverse Image Technology


The internet is a vast space, and sometimes a simple text search doesn’t cut it. That's where modern image lookup tools come in, offering users advanced ways to explore the digital world.


Instead of relying solely on keywords, visual search allows you to upload or paste an image URL and find visually similar pictures, sources, and relevant content. This is particularly helpful for content creators, students, journalists, and even online shoppers who come across a photo and want to learn more about it.


There are several tools available online that provide reverse lookup services. Some focus on social media sourcing, while others are tailored toward identifying manipulated or fake images. The accuracy and results often depend on how powerful the tool’s algorithms are and the size of its database.


When you're choosing a tool for your image tracing needs, consider how well it integrates with your browser, its speed, and the types of files it supports. Some tools are basic, offering only a simple upload and match function, while others give detailed metadata, search filters, and even allow you to see how an image has been used across the internet.


People commonly use this technology for spotting image theft, tracking down product listings, or discovering artwork details. If you’re a digital artist or photographer, being able to trace where your content appears online is incredibly useful. Similarly, educators and researchers use these tools to verify photo authenticity and detect potential misinformation.

Even better, many tools are free or have generous free versions, which means powerful visual searches are accessible to anyone with an internet connection.


Privacy is another major factor. Be sure to use services that don't store or misuse your uploads. Reading through privacy policies is important, especially if you're uploading personal or sensitive visuals.


So what makes a reverse image tool truly valuable? Fast scanning, broad internet coverage, and intuitive results presentation are some of the key features. Some platforms are also starting to use AI to better understand context and match results more accurately.
